NCUK partners with the University of Dundee

University of Dundee

NCUK proudly welcomes the University of Dundee as a new partner in Scotland, UK, joining its growing global network.

Through this partnership, students who complete the NCUK International Foundation Year (IFY) at University Foundation College (UFC), the only NCUK Study Centre in Qatar, will have guaranteed progression to the University of Dundee, subject to meeting entry requirements.

The University of Dundee is ranked 26th in the UK in The Guardian University Guide 2026, reflecting a significant rise of 26 places from the previous year.

Founded in 1881, the university has three campuses: City, Ninewells, and Kirkcaldy. The City campus is located in the heart of Dundee, the fourth largest city in Scotland.

As a research intensive institution, University of Dundee offers high quality courses in Life Sciences, Law, Pharmacy and Pharmacology, Biological Sciences, Art & Design, Nursing, and Medicine. Ranked first in Bioengineering and Biomedical Engineering, and second for Medicine and Dentistry in The Times and The Sunday Times Good University Guide 2026, Dundee stands out as a strong choice for students looking for competitive and diverse degree options.

Dundee offers a vibrant mix of nightlife, arts, and outdoor activities, with renowned galleries and museums alongside a wide range of options such as water sports, golf, climbing, bowling, and football for students to enjoy.

At the heart of the campus, the Main Library serves as a modern study hub, featuring 3D printers and extensive digital resources. Beyond the classroom, students are supported by an on campus Health Service and a dedicated International Advice Service, offering guidance on immigration and everyday matters. From the social “buddy system” of Peer Connectors to the welcoming Global Room, Dundee ensures every student feels at home and ready to succeed in the UK.
